Default Dealership is covering the rust problem

My 2005 Coupe goes in tomorrow morning. I was surfing the threads and I came across a thread by Andrew about the rust problems some crossfires have at the bottom of the door. I went outside and checked it out and sure enough the rail that holds the weather stripping in is completely rusted out (sorry no pics). I called up my Chrysler dealership 3 days ago and I got a call yesterday saying there will cover it under the 5 year rust warranty.

I'll update the thread when I get my XF back. They said it could take about 2 days.

Default Re: Dealership is covering the rust problem

They told me that the rust was not bad enough to replace the entire doors since it was only on the railing and underneath. He told me there body shop was going to "blast" of the rust put down a primer, coat it with some kind of rubber sealant then put there weather stripping back in. I will inspect the job when its done. They did tell me though if they do start working on it and it looks really bad or didn't notice something the first time they saw it (when they inspected it and took pics) they will call me back with those 2 options as stated before.
